Wales will believe shock result possible

Caelan Doris feels that, just like Ireland against England, Wales will feel they have a big performance in them.

Andy Farrell’s side had struggled in the aftermath of winning the 2024 Six Nations, losing meekly to New Zealand (twice), France (twice) and South Africa.

Amid concern around the trajectory of the team, the squad and management had been steadfast in their belief that they would soon turn the corner, which they duly did in a barnstorming 42-21 demolition job in Twickenham.
